Luton to Norwich train travel explained
Want to know how to get from Luton to Norwich by train? We have gathered for you all the useful information about this trip!
The fastest trains from Luton to Norwich take around 2 hours and 37 minutes, covering a distance of approximately 143 kilometres.
On weekdays, the first train leaving Luton is scheduled to depart at around 00:04. The last departure is usually at around 23:13 . On Saturdays and Sundays, trains leave Luton at around 00:04, with the last train leaving at around 23:41. There are frequent services on this particular rail route. On average, there are about 59 trains per day travelling between the two cities. They leave approximately every 14 minutes.
Prices for a single ticket between the two cities start from €36.55.

Is there a direct train from Luton to Norwich?
The journey between Luton and Norwich usually involves one change of train.
We usually find at least one departure on the route from Luton to Norwich every weekday that leave enough time to change trains without waiting around for longer than necessary.
Trains are typically more frequent on weekends, when we found at least one departure.
How long does it take to travel from Luton to Norwich?
The Luton to Norwich train travel takes about 2 hours and 37 minutes, no matter when you leave.
What are the Luton to Norwich train times and schedule?
If you're travelling on a weekday, you'll find the earliest train to Norwich leaving Luton at around 00:04 and the last train leaving at around 23:13 . At weekends, the first train of the day leaves Luton at around 00:04, with the final departure at 23:41.
